Summary:
Akeelah Anderson, an eleven-year-old girl with a love for words, must overcome her insecurities, her difficult home life, and a more experienced and privileged field of competitors to compete in the Scripps National Spelling Bee, and unwittingly unites an entire neighborhood in supporting her.
